Special Rates

CARICOM Preferential Rate
0%
Applicable to imports from CARICOM member states; does not apply to imports from the United States unless under specific trade agreements.

U.S. Increases Exports of Data Processing Machines to Guyana
The U.S. reported a significant rise in exports of automatic data processing machines (HS Code 8471) to Guyana, driven by growing demand for IT infrastructure in the region.
2023-10-15
Impact: This increase strengthens trade ties and supports Guyana's digital transformation, potentially leading to higher future demand for U.S. technology products.
Guyana Seeks U.S. Technology for Oil Sector Data Management
Guyana's expanding oil industry has led to a surge in demand for data processing units and magnetic readers from the U.S. to manage large-scale data operations.
2023-09-20
Impact: This trend is expected to boost U.S. exports under HS Code 8471, fostering deeper economic collaboration in technology sectors.
